My Review Of Close Calls By Rachel Cann

Rachel Cann’s “Close Calls,” published on December 6, 2022, is a gripping Creative Nonfiction that delves into the author’s harrowing real-life experiences. From being kidnapped to enduring homelessness for two years, Cann shares a series of shocking events that will leave you spellbound.

Her resilience and strength in the face of adversity are truly inspiring. This book is an emotional rollercoaster that I couldn’t put down. I finished it in one sitting, captivated by Cann’s narrative.
